ABSTRACT:
A switched mode power supply is provided which combines voltage regulation and power factor correction in a single converter stage. The power supply comprises a bridge rectifier feeding a double rectified voltage sine wave to a flyback converter comprising input and output circuits connected by an energy-storing transformer. The input circuit comprises an energy-storing inductor, a switching device connected in series with the inductor across the output of the bridge rectifier, a control arrangement for controlling the cyclic turning on and off of the switching device, and a coupling capacitor connected in series with the primary winding of the transformer across the switching device. The control arrangement comprises switch-on timing means for turning on the switching device upon a turn-on condition being reached in which the inductor and transformer have stored energy levels such that the inductor and transformer are equally balanced to charge one another, and on-time control means for maintaining the switching device on for a period dependent on the desired value of said regulated dc output voltage. In this manner, the converter input current is made proportional to the input voltage giving the desired high power factor.
